Deane Lester’s Melbourne Cup Day Best Bets Posted on November 2, 2020November 3, 2020 | Posted by Deane Lester RACE 4 NO.10 YULONG RISING YULONG RISING is working up to another win and looks the value runner of the day when he contests the Benchmark 96 Handicap (2800m). The six year old worked home well when finishing 3rd behind VEGAS KNIGHT over 2000 metres at Caulfield on October 14. He drops 5kg for that run and will appreciate a step up in distance. He’s a handy stayer that ran 5th behind KING OF LEOGRANCE in this year’s Adelaide Cup which is a useful form reference for this class of race. In an even contest, YULONG RISING appears to be over the odds and should run a bold race. RACE 5 NO.2 AIN’TNODEELDUN AIN’TNODEELDUN has been racing in good form and represents the best bet of the day when he runs in the TAB Trophy (1800m). The son of Dundeel scored a spectacular win over 1600 metres at Sale two starts back before recording a tough win in the Hill-Smith Stakes (1800m) at Morphettville on October 10. In that race, she defeated VICTORIA QUAY and that filly went on to win last Saturday’s Group 2 Wakeful Stakes (2000m). It looks an irresistible formline for this race as he progresses onto better class races. The Freedman stable have been going well in recent weeks and AIN’TNODEELDUN can provide them with another winner. RACE 7 NO.21 TIGER MOTH This year’s Melbourne Cup (3200m) looks one of the strongest in recent history with a host of solid formlines, however the lightest raced horse in the field TIGER MOTH is an exciting staying talent that can provide world renowned trainer Aidan O’Brien with his first cup and champion jockey Kerrin McEvoy a fourth win in the race that stops the nation. The son of Galileo rounded off his campaign for the Cup with a stunning win in the Group 3 Kilternan Stakes (2400m) at Leopardstown on September 12. It was the run of an emerging star and, with just 52.5kg, makes plenty of appeal to win the great race. MELBOURNE CUP 1. TIGER MOTH 2. PRINCE OF ARRAN 3. ANTHONY VAN DYCK 4.
